    Crafting Artisan's File - First OH Attempt

    Hello. I'm mostly prepared to begin crafting OH Artisan tools. However whenever I search 3star rotations, every reddit or such I find is talking about rotations for token/turn-in items or 40 dura.

    Right now, I'm looking to craft my first Artisan's OH tool, and I'm just wanting to be as prepared as possible b/c I hate the idea of blowing up a weeks worth of ixali tribe quests.

    Also, I'd hate to end up with a NQ when just a little more research I could have HQ'd.

    My current BSM stats: craft-414, con-381, GP-351 (before food).

    I also plan on popping crafting FC actions +10 to both craft and control.

    Anyone have some links, or first-hand experience they can share about this stage?

    Or am i just overthinking it, and it's not that difficult?

    First,
    http://www.ffxivcrafter.com/crafting...ep=selectclass

    Use this to model your sequence. Namely how you plan to get the progress done.
    In general it is better to pre-plan your progress such that you can finish with 1-2 CS2's WITHOUT Ingenuity 1/2.
    This lets you use a CS2 to fish for a condition, and lets you go into a finishing rotation with 78 CP (SH1-GS-BB) or 96 CP (SH1-GS-Inno-BB) and 20 CP if you need 1 CS2, or 30 Dur to do 2 CS2's, using 1 to fish.

    With your 414+10 = 424 craftsmanship, you can do the following... assuming you have everything at 50.
    SH2 - 3x PbP - RS, that'll leave you at 435/445, so 1 CS2 to finish.
    Or
    SH2 - 2x PbP - RS, and 2 CS2's. Thats 15 less CP, 10 more durability, 1 extra chance to fish, depending on Inno use.

    Personally I've found that 3-4 star crafting is about conditional rotations.
    For instance: (Doing a BB-CS2x2 finisher)
    IF Dur = 30 AND CP >= 78 -> Do finisher.
    IF Dur >= 30 AND CP >= 195 -> Master's Mend - SH2 - HT's till 30 Dur, hit ToTs.
    IF Dur = 20 or 10 AND CP >= 288 -> Master's Mend 2 - SH2 - HT's - SH2 - HT's till 30 Dur.

    That kind of logic works pretty well. Just keep hitting ToTs, refresh CZ at least once. Twice is questionable unless you end up with a LOT of ToTs letting the 1st and 2nd tick down well before the finisher.

    It's the same as any regular 3* craft.

    If you can HQ Wolfram Ingots from NQ materials, you will have absolutely no problem HQ`ing these offhands.


    You can start with some HQ materials to help a little.
    Aim for 9-10 stacks of Inner Quiet and buff as much as you can (Great Strides, Ingenuity 2, Innovation) for Byregot and you are sure to reach 100% hq chance.

    I use Piece by Piece once + 2 Rapid Synth + 1 Careful Synth II for progress.

    www.ffxivcrafter.com to calculate what is needed to finish your progress, you want to make sure you only need one CSII to finish the craft in the end.

    This is the best rotation I have tried so far for 3 star/ 3.9 star token/ 4 star items, you can use Hasty touches about 12+/- times, but you will need to figure out during the WN II whether or not you need to use ToT.
    (I have been using it to get all 8 master book II. 8 off hands and all 4 star artisan's gears)

    https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=qzO43-1-EPg

    Edited: GSM rotation would be different, since you will need to choose 2 out of these 3 skills (RS, SH II, Rclaim)
